★ Insight ───────────────────────────────────── - Multi-agent code review distributes specialized analysis: code quality, test coverage, simplification, type design, and architecture each get a dedicated reviewer rather than overloading one general reviewer. - "Conventional Comments" is a structured format (<label> [decorations]: <subject>) that makes review feedback actionable — labels like praise:, nitpick:, suggestion:, issue:, question:, thought:, chore: set clear intent. ─────────────────────────────────────────────────

★ Insight ───────────────────────────────────── - The three reviewers converged on the same critical finding (authorization-scope narrowing for practices/connector_configurations_controller) from three different angles — semantic correctness (CR), test gap (TA), structural clarity (CS). When parallel reviewers triangulate on the same line, that's a strong "request changes" signal. - The PR has a subtle behavioral shift on #destroy/#update: previously a wrong-org admin got 404 (record outside scoped_connectors); now they get 403 (found via base_scope, then authorize rejects). Functionally fine, but it's an externally-observable contract change worth pinning with a test. ─────────────────────────────────────────────────

engines/ti_connect/app/policies/ti_connect/application_scope.rb

L5praise (CR): Nice migration to the public Organizations::Api::Get.organization_ids_for boundary — engine-API compliance is correct.

L9–11question (CR): Should current_account_managed_practice_ids also go through a public API? current_account.managed_organization_ids lives on the monolith AccountAuthorization concern (which itself calls OrganizationAdmin::Api::Get.organizations_for(...).pluck(:id)). For consistency with the line you just changed, consider whether OrganizationAdmin::Api::Get.organization_ids_for(account_ids: current_account.id) (or equivalent) would be the preferred boundary call. Not blocking — worth verifying with the owners.

L3–7nitpick (CS): Naming clarity — current_account_practice_ids vs current_account_managed_practice_ids The unmarked one is the broader read scope, which is the opposite of what most readers expect. Rename to current_account_member_practice_ids for symmetry.

L3–7suggestion (CS): The two helpers differ only in their organization-id source — share a private extractor

def current_account_practice_ids
  practice_ids_for(::Organizations::Api::Get.organization_ids_for(account_id: current_account.id))
end
def current_account_managed_practice_ids
  practice_ids_for(current_account.managed_organization_ids)
end
private
def practice_ids_for(organization_ids)
  CalendarManagement::Base::Practice.where(organization_id: organization_ids).pluck(:id)
end

Minor — two lines of duplication is borderline. Take it or leave it.

L13–16suggestion (CS): with_preloaded_associations could drop its scope arg Every caller passes the implicit scope from the surrounding scope_for block:

def preloaded_scope
  scope.preload(:deprecated_practice, :ti_connect_clients)
end

(Skip if scope isn't reliably available outside an explicit block argument in V2::ApplicationScope — verify in one place.)

L13suggestion (test, TA): Add a test that asserts preload actually loads the associations (e.g. assert_predicate scope.first.association(:deprecated_practice), :loaded?) — the comment warns about cross-database joins; without an assertion, a silent regression to joins would only show up at runtime.


engines/ti_connect/app/policies/ti_connect/configuration_policy.rb

L6–8praise (CR): Clean reuse of with_preloaded_associations keeps Scope classes symmetric.

L1–4suggestion (CS): Collapse the duplicated allow blocks

# before
allow(:write) { to(:doctor) { authorized_organization_admin? } }
allow(:read)  { to(:doctor) { authorized_organization_admin? } }

# after
allow(%i[read write]) { to(:doctor) { authorized_organization_admin? } }

Verify your V2::ApplicationPolicy DSL supports the array form before applying.
